Definitions and Meaning of ganglion in English
ganglion (n)
an encapsulated neural structure consisting of a collection of cell bodies or neurons
ganglion (n.)
A mass or knot of nervous matter, including nerve cells, usually forming an enlargement in the course of a nerve.
A node, or gland in the lymphatic system; as, a lymphatic ganglion.
A globular, hard, indolent tumor, situated somewhere on a tendon, and commonly formed by the effusion of a viscid fluid into it; -- called also weeping sinew.
